
The public profile of Marc Thiessen, former chief speechwriter for Donald Rumsfeld and George W. Bush and current terrorism pundit, soared this year following the publication of his book Courting Disaster: How the CIA Kept America Safe and How Barack Obama Is Inviting the Next Attack, which was blurbed by such conservative luminaries as Dick Cheney.
But now the New Yorker's Jane Mayer has published a scathing review of the book that challenges not only Thiessen's defense of "brutal interrogations" but also some of his basic factual claims.
